Quarterly Planning Note — Finance

Revised commission scheme for Corvane Systems takes effect next quarter. Base rate drops to 4%; accelerators kick in above 110% of target. Multi-year Lattik deals earn a 1.5x multiplier. Clawbacks apply to cancellations within 90 days. Model the payout impact by week three. One further point is strictly confidential.

management briefing: Rusathek Logistics plans to lower the Oliir list price by 35.0 percent in July. The board signed off on a budget of $225.5 million for Project Ulador. The renewal with Quenaxix Foods closes at $345.9 million a year, 30.3 percent above the last contract. Project Quenius slips by two quarters because of the staffing delay.

TURN-208: Gatevale turnstile counters at the Merrow Field pilot double-count when a rotation reverses mid-cycle. Attendance totals drift roughly 2% high per event. The debounce window fix is implemented, reviewed by Ilsa, and soak-tested across two simulated match days without drift. Ready for your cut; the candidate build is identified below.

trace token, tagag-tafog: htk6_5ed18c

Ticket for the record: the render-cache warmer for the Quillpane templating service failed silently for six days because its service credentials expired, which is why template rendering latency crept from 40ms to 310ms. Caches were cold on every request. Credentials have been rotated and the warmer is running again; latency is back to baseline. Future maintainers: set a 14-day expiry alert on this account. The warmer authenticates against the cache tier with the key below:

service key, fawip-bajef: kto11_Qt5wZK9vdNC